legongju.com
我们一直在努力
2024-12-26 08:41 | 星期四

RubyORM新手如何学习

对于Ruby ORM新手来说,学习Ruby ORM涉及掌握Ruby语言基础、理解ORM概念,以及学习如何使用Ruby ORM框架来操作数据库。以下是学习Ruby ORM的步骤和资源推荐:

学习步骤

  1. 掌握Ruby语言基础

    • 学习Ruby的基本语法,如变量赋值、条件语句、数组和迭代器等。
    • 推荐资源:菜鸟教程提供了编程的基础技术教程,包括Ruby的基础知识。
  2. 理解ORM(对象关系映射)概念

    • ORM是一种将关系型数据库中的数据转换为面向对象编程语言中的对象的技术。
    • 学习ORM的优点和可能的缺点,以及它是如何简化数据库操作的。
  3. 学习Ruby ORM框架

    • Ruby on Rails是一个流行的Web开发框架,它默认集成了Active Record ORM。
    • 通过构建一个简单的Web应用来实践使用Active Record。

推荐资源

  • 菜鸟教程:提供编程的基础技术教程,包括Ruby的基础知识。
  • 《Ruby Best Practices》:由Gregory Brown编写,是一本提供Ruby编程语言最佳实践的权威指南。
  • Try Ruby:无需安装,只需通过浏览器即可体验Ruby。
  • Ruby Koans:通过交互式练习学习Ruby。

通过以上步骤和资源,Ruby ORM新手可以逐步建立起对Ruby ORM的理解和应用能力。

未经允许不得转载 » 本文链接:https://www.legongju.com/article/18092.html

相关推荐

  • Ruby元编程如何优化代码结构

    Ruby元编程如何优化代码结构

    Ruby 元编程是一种强大的技术,它允许程序在运行时动态地创建或修改代码。这种灵活性虽然强大,但也可能导致代码结构变得复杂和难以维护。为了优化 Ruby 元编程的...

  • Ruby元编程怎样应对复杂需求

    Ruby元编程怎样应对复杂需求

    Ruby 是一种非常灵活和强大的编程语言,它支持元编程,这使得开发者可以在运行时动态地创建或修改代码。应对复杂需求时,Ruby 的元编程能力可以发挥巨大的作用。...

  • Ruby元编程有哪些实用技巧

    Ruby元编程有哪些实用技巧

    Ruby 是一种非常灵活和强大的编程语言,它支持元编程,这是一种在运行时动态地生成或修改代码的技术。以下是一些 Ruby 元编程的实用技巧: 使用 define_method 动...

  • Ruby元编程如何增强代码灵活性

    Ruby元编程如何增强代码灵活性

    Ruby 是一种动态、反射的语言,它允许程序员在运行时修改和扩展代码。这种能力使得 Ruby 成为一种非常灵活的编程语言。元编程是 Ruby 中的一种强大特性,它允许程...

  • RubyORM有哪些优势特点

    RubyORM有哪些优势特点

    RubyORM(Object-Relational Mapping,对象关系映射)是一种编程技术,它允许开发者使用面向对象的方式来操作数据库。Ruby有许多流行的ORM库,如ActiveRecord、D...

  • RubyORM怎样处理关联数据

    RubyORM怎样处理关联数据

    Ruby ORM(Object-Relational Mapping)是一种将对象模型映射到关系型数据库的技术。在Ruby中,有多种ORM库可以帮助我们处理关联数据,例如ActiveRecord、DataMa...

  • RubyORM能实现复杂查询吗

    RubyORM能实现复杂查询吗

    是的,Ruby ORM(对象关系映射)库可以帮助您实现复杂查询。Ruby中有几个流行的ORM库,如ActiveRecord、DataMapper和Sequel等。这些库都提供了丰富的功能来帮助您...

  • RubyORM安全性如何维护

    RubyORM安全性如何维护

    Ruby ORM(对象关系映射)是一种将数据库表映射到Ruby类的方法,以便更方便地操作数据库。在Ruby中,有几个流行的ORM库,如ActiveRecord、DataMapper和Sequel等。...